CCMF Takes Center Stage for America’s 250th Birthday
This wasn’t just any regular Fourth of July—this year, the nation celebrated its milestone 250th birthday! Hosted by America’s Got Talent star Terry Crews, the two-hour NBC special was an absolute blockbuster, featuring a mind-blowing 85,000 fireworks shells and a massive laser show from the Brooklyn Bridge.
But while New York City had the fireworks, NBC knew exactly where to find the best crowd and the hottest music on the planet: Myrtle Beach, South Carolina! Our incredible CCMF fans became the face of the national celebration. Seeing that ocean breeze, the glowing Ferris wheel, and a sea of tens of thousands of country fans singing along on national television was nothing short of magical.
